Master in Mechanical Engineering
The Master of Engineering in Mechanical Engineering is a 30 credit hour degree program. It is intended to be a terminal degree program designed for those who wish to become a leader in the mechanical engineering field.
This degree is particularly well-suited for students who wish to study part-time, for those interested in updating their technical skills, or for those not focused on a research-oriented Master of Science thesis. A conventional thesis is not required for the program. In its place, students complete a capstone experience, which may be a design project leadership course, a well-organized and carefully chosen industrial internship, or a project with a paper option. A research methods course may also fulfill the capstone experience.
Three focus areas, specializations, are offered at RIT Dubai: Sustainability, Thermo/Fluids Engineering and Mechanics, and Design. Part-time working students have the option of attending evening classes.
Career Options
Because of their comprehensive training and education, mechanical engineers are often called upon to assume management positions. They work in many different industries and businesses as product developers, researchers, prototype designers, automotive engineers, aerospace engineers, management consultants, among many others and many serve in senior leadership positions in their fields.
